Gold prices surged to a record high, with XAU/USD breaking the $4,750 barrier and reaching an impressive $4,766 on Tuesday. This rally was primarily driven by increasing geopolitical tensions, particularly the ongoing trade war between the United States and the European Union. The heightened uncertainty in the market has pushed investors towards safe-haven assets, marking a significant shift in trading psychology.
Compounding the situation, a rise in global bond yields followed a lackluster 20-year debt auction earlier in the day, prompting further selling pressure on US assets. As traders recalibrate their positions in response to these developments, the USD faces challenges against a backdrop of rising gold prices, which typically signal a weakening currency exchange rate. This dynamic is likely to influence forex trading strategies as investors seek refuge in gold amidst a turbulent market environment.
